network-manager in Jessie upgrade issues



I upgraded from Wheezy to Jessie today on my laptop. I cannot get wifi to work now. I have been using network-manager with KDE for years now. I tried removing everything network-manager related through apt and starting over but that didn't work. I have network-manager and plasma-widget-networkmanagement installed and can configure interfaces through the GUI. Wired works, but wireless never fully connects no matter if security (WPA2) is being used or not. See attached log.

I tried using Wicd and it worked fine to connect to wifi so I don't think my hardware is at fault.

I am currently trying to figure out how to get more verbose logging from either network-manager or the wpa supplicant, all docs I can find seem irrelevant so at least looking for tips on that.
